The 126th edition of French Open started on May 22 at Roland Garros with crowds back to their no-mask, no-distancing, full-capacity, pre-pandemic levels Sunday. In the first round actions, Alexander Zverev, Carlos Alcaraz, Felix Auger-Aliassime, Maria Sakkari and Coco Gauff were the big winners. Seeds to crash out were Ons Jabeur and Garbine Muguruza.
